mirror of
https://codeberg.org/forgejo/forgejo.git
synced 2024-11-10 17:18:59 +00:00
51fb0463a3
* Fix truncated organization names Previous ellipsis implementation hid vertical overflow - image + descent line of letters. Organization visibility in select on dashboard was not always visible. This commit extracts classes which don't make collisions with other items on page.
204 lines
3.2 KiB
Plaintext
204 lines
3.2 KiB
Plaintext
.dashboard {
|
|
&.feeds,
|
|
&.issues {
|
|
.context.user.menu {
|
|
z-index: 101;
|
|
min-width: 200px;
|
|
|
|
.ui.header {
|
|
font-size: 1rem;
|
|
text-transform: none;
|
|
}
|
|
}
|
|
|
|
.filter.menu {
|
|
width: initial;
|
|
|
|
.item {
|
|
text-align: left;
|
|
|
|
.text {
|
|
height: 16px;
|
|
vertical-align: middle;
|
|
|
|
&.truncate {
|
|
width: 75%;
|
|
}
|
|
}
|
|
|
|
.floating.label {
|
|
top: 7px;
|
|
left: 90%;
|
|
width: 15%;
|
|
|
|
@media @mediaSm {
|
|
top: 10px;
|
|
left: auto;
|
|
width: auto;
|
|
right: 13px;
|
|
}
|
|
}
|
|
}
|
|
|
|
// Sort
|
|
.jump.item {
|
|
margin: 1px;
|
|
padding-right: 0;
|
|
}
|
|
|
|
.menu {
|
|
max-height: 300px;
|
|
overflow-x: auto;
|
|
right: 0 !important;
|
|
left: auto !important;
|
|
}
|
|
|
|
@media @mediaSm {
|
|
width: 100%;
|
|
}
|
|
}
|
|
|
|
.right.stackable.menu > .item.active {
|
|
color: var(--color-red);
|
|
}
|
|
}
|
|
|
|
.dashboard-repos,
|
|
.dashboard-orgs {
|
|
margin: 0 1px; /* Accomodate for Semantic's 1px hacks on .attached elements */
|
|
}
|
|
|
|
.dashboard-navbar {
|
|
width: 100vw;
|
|
padding-left: .5rem;
|
|
padding-right: .5rem;
|
|
.org-visibility .label {
|
|
margin-left: 5px;
|
|
}
|
|
|
|
.ui.dropdown {
|
|
max-width: 100%;
|
|
}
|
|
}
|
|
}
|
|
|
|
&.feeds {
|
|
.news {
|
|
li {
|
|
display: flex;
|
|
align-items: baseline;
|
|
margin-top: .5rem;
|
|
margin-bottom: .5rem;
|
|
|
|
img {
|
|
align-self: flex-start;
|
|
}
|
|
}
|
|
li > * + * {
|
|
margin-left: .35rem;
|
|
}
|
|
|
|
line-height: 1.2;
|
|
|
|
> .ui.grid {
|
|
margin-left: auto;
|
|
margin-right: auto;
|
|
}
|
|
|
|
.left .ui.avatar {
|
|
margin-top: 13px;
|
|
}
|
|
|
|
.time-since {
|
|
font-size: 13px;
|
|
}
|
|
|
|
.issue.title {
|
|
width: 80%;
|
|
margin: 0 0 1em;
|
|
}
|
|
|
|
.push.news .content ul {
|
|
line-height: 18px;
|
|
font-size: 13px;
|
|
list-style: none;
|
|
padding-left: 10px;
|
|
|
|
.text.truncate {
|
|
width: 80%;
|
|
}
|
|
}
|
|
|
|
.commit-id {
|
|
font-family: var(--fonts-monospace);
|
|
}
|
|
|
|
code {
|
|
padding: 1px;
|
|
font-size: 85%;
|
|
background-color: rgba(0, 0, 0, .04);
|
|
border-radius: 3px;
|
|
word-break: break-all;
|
|
}
|
|
|
|
&:last-of-type .divider {
|
|
display: none !important;
|
|
}
|
|
}
|
|
|
|
.list {
|
|
ul {
|
|
list-style: none;
|
|
margin: 0;
|
|
padding-left: 0;
|
|
|
|
li {
|
|
&:not(:last-child) {
|
|
border-bottom: 1px solid var(--color-secondary);
|
|
}
|
|
|
|
&.private {
|
|
background-color: #fcf8e9;
|
|
}
|
|
|
|
.repo-list-link {
|
|
padding: 6px 1em;
|
|
display: block;
|
|
|
|
.svg {
|
|
color: var(--color-text-light-2);
|
|
}
|
|
|
|
.star-num {
|
|
font-size: 12px;
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
#privateFilterCheckbox .svg {
|
|
color: #888888;
|
|
margin-right: .25rem;
|
|
}
|
|
|
|
.repo-owner-name-list {
|
|
.item-name {
|
|
max-width: 70%;
|
|
margin-bottom: -4px;
|
|
}
|
|
}
|
|
|
|
#collaborative-repo-list {
|
|
.owner-and-repo {
|
|
max-width: 80%;
|
|
margin-bottom: -5px;
|
|
}
|
|
|
|
.owner-name {
|
|
max-width: 120px;
|
|
margin-bottom: -5px;
|
|
}
|
|
}
|
|
}
|
|
}
|